Address NF66VX11zWyEeHNWZa9o62v7ejJopsXrB1

Total received 46.83941079 NMC
Total sent 46.83941079 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Sept. 5, 2022, 11:43 p.m. 8fd46a13c… 628513 46.83941079 NMC 0.00000000 NMC
Sept. 5, 2022, 11:43 p.m. 1b59a1594… 628513 46.83941079 NMC 0.00000000 NMC